Frequently Asked Questions about Cheap Ann Arbor Apartments

What is a cheap apartment in Ann Arbor?

A cheap apartment is any apartment up to the 30% percentile of cost for the area, which in Ann Arbor is under $995.

What is the price of a cheap apartment in Ann Arbor?

The cheapest apartment in Ann Arbor is 1803 Hill St which is listed at $825, while the average apartment in Ann Arbor costs $1,792.

What types of apartments are the cheapest in Ann Arbor?

Student, low-income, and by-the-bed apartments are typically the cheapest rentals in most cities, though they require qualifying criteria to rent. There are 12,147 regular apartments in Ann Arbor that we think qualify as ‘cheap apartments’ that do not have special requirements to apply to rent.

How do the prices of cheap apartments compare to the average apartment in Ann Arbor?

Cheap apartments in Ann Arbor have an average cost of $1,279 which is $513 cheaper than the average rent for all rentals in Ann Arbor.
